Giant-slayer Gonzaga ascends to No. 1 in AP poll
Long climb to the top
SPOKANE, Wash. — It means nothing, and yet it means everything.
Gonzaga’s men’s basketball program achieved a height Monday that once would have been deemed unimaginable, being voted No. 1 in both major-college polls for the first time in school history.
The honor won’t help the Zags win games in the NCAA tournament just ahead, and it could even be a burden, bringing with it intense media scrutiny and the inevitable loss of the underdog status that has served Gonzaga so well.
